Transaction 16d2ef71d21affde9c43c1b444e9838382b510bb0a493776f0e9ddd47ea1a65c
1 Input
1 Output
-
16d2ef71d21affde9c43c1b444e9838382b510bb0a493776f0e9ddd47ea1a65c:0
- value
- 2074686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22bb5139a018faa92070e89a89ba81d2e4919710 OP_EQUAL
- address
- 34rfJ6hpHET5poRSaKoWto55ijDH6fsFt2